I am a mixed media artist working primarily in cold wax and oil, and encaustic, with ample portions of other drawing and painting media mixed in as needed. I find great satisfaction in the marriage of seemingly ill suited materials, a nod to my first love of collage and assemblage. Although the majority of my work is technically two dimensional, much of my work features three dimensional sculptural elements that taunt the viewer with the suggestion of another layer, plane or surface of perspective – obscured or exposed- exploring the notion that not all is revealed or understood upon first blush or experience. I work abstractly in an effort to reconcile seemingly disparate contexts, materials and mark making methods; for me, harmony often resides in the recognition of dissonance. If it feels counter intuitive, I am likely attracted to it, and will explore it. My painting and drawing work explores the juxtaposition of the organic and linear, the sparse and saturated, with color playing a major role. My encaustic work focuses on the minimalist aesthetic of subtle variation within repetition and pattern. Why this toggling between movement filled colorful abstract drawings, pared down geometric studies in wax? For me, these notions reflect an everyday struggle – the perennial too much/not enough paradigm our current society jockeys within, and with which I grapple myself. Which is it? Does it depend on the day, the mood, the company you keep? Is there great solace in austerity, or presumed safety in indulgence? I explore these concepts by building up or stripping down layers of tension and release with color, line, form and pattern. I was born in Washington D.C and spent the balance of my young adult life in Massachusetts and New England. Following my college studies, I continued to develop my own art practice, while managing several art galleries featuring contemporary work in sculpture, ceramics, and painting, from East Africa to China & the U.S. I currently live and work in the Western North Carolina Mountain region of the U.S. My work has been exhibited in galleries and collections in Massachusetts, New York, California, North Carolina, and the U.K. I am currently represented by Contemporaneo Asheville Gallery, in the burgeoning city of Asheville, NC. I facilitate and conduct workshops in encaustic, cold wax and mixed media both at the Contemporaneo Gallery and in my own studio.
